Hong Min was the Ancestor of Humanity. He was created from the Blue Sea of Life, the place where all living beings were born. He had several children, and together with them he experienced and created countless legends. The life stories of Hong Min and his children were recorded in a legendary book known by all humans, called The Legend of Hong Min.

One of the oldest legends spoke of the 'Emblem of Choice', the 'Emblem of Opportunity', and the 'Emblem of Hope'. In that legend, when the world was newly formed, it was a wild land of untamed forests. Savage beasts roamed the earth, bringing disaster and destruction.

Hong Min, however, was created in a separate place. He lived on a remote island.

The island was filled with dense forests, lush plants, and a small lake that served as a source of fresh water.

Those who lived on the island would never lack anything in life.

Beyond the island, endless seawater surrounded it. The blue ocean stretched so far that it seemed to have no end.

Hong Min lived happily. Everything he needed existed on the island.

Yet after living there for a long time, he realized how small his world truly was.

He longed for a greater world to explore.

When noon arrived, Hong Min returned to the forest to gather wild mushrooms for his evening meal.

This time, by pure coincidence, he encountered the 'Emblem of Choice'.

When he saw the Emblem of Choice, Hong Min ran toward it.

When Hong Min arrived before the Emblem of Choice, before he could speak, it spoke first.

"Oh human, why choose to run when you can walk? In the end, both will lead you to your destination."

Hong Min shook his head.

"I am afraid that if I do not run, you will leave first. There is something I wish to ask you."

"What do you wish to ask me, Hong Min?" the Emblem of Choice asked.

Without hesitation, Hong Min asked many questions at once.

"Is the world really only this small?"

"Is there another world at the end of the boundless sea?"

"If there is another world beyond the sea, is there other life there?"

"And if so, how vast is the world beyond?"

Hong Min asked with burning enthusiasm, one question after another.

Listening to the flood of questions, the Emblem of Choice interrupted him.

"Oh Hong Min, instead of asking me, why don't you go and see it for yourself?" the Emblem of Choice offered the most logical suggestion.

Hong Min shook his head. He feared that there was no other world beyond his own.

He feared that if he left, he would lose the world he currently had. Yet deep in his heart, he desperately wished to go.

Seeing his hesitation, the Emblem of Choice was about to speak—but the 'Emblem of Opportunity' appeared.

After boarding the ship, Hong Min entered the small cabin within it. Heavy rain and raging winds carried the vessel farther and farther away from the island.

When the rain finally subsided, Hong Min stepped out of the cabin.

Accompanied by the Emblem of Opportunity, he felt a surging, blazing spirit within his heart.

Days passed into days. Weeks turned into weeks. Months followed one after another.

The stock of food and fresh water on the ship gradually diminished.

At last, Hong Min complained to the Emblem of Opportunity.

"Emblem of Opportunity, when will my chance to reach another world arrive? I have already taken the risk of leaving my world behind," Hong Min said bitterly.

"Oh Hong Min, did I ever force you to leave your world?" the Emblem of Opportunity replied coldly.

"You left by your own choice, and you were prepared to bear the consequences of that choice. So why do you complain to me now?"

Hong Min fell silent once more. He could not refute the Emblem of Opportunity, for everything that had happened was indeed the result of his own decision—to see a world greater than the one he once knew.

Another month passed after Hong Min's complaint.

From that day on, Hong Min remained shut inside his cabin.

His spirit faded. His food supplies dwindled.

He began to realize that all his dreams of another world were nothing more than imagination.

Reality struck him harshly.

He had sailed for months, yet all he encountered was an endless sea.

The Emblem of Opportunity felt pity as it watched Hong Min's condition.

"Oh Hong Min, I have a way for us to reach our destination faster."

Hong Min's once-empty eyes shone again with hope.

"How?" Hong Min asked, his voice short yet urgent.

"Tonight, leave your cabin. Gaze upon the endless sea with genuine hope for another world. If you do so, you will meet 'him,'" the Emblem of Opportunity explained.

When night fell, Hong Min stepped out of his cabin.

He looked up at the full moon hanging high in the sky, adorned by countless stars.

The night wind pierced his skin, but following the advice of the Emblem of Opportunity, he chose to endure.

Time passed. Minutes felt like hours as he suffered in the cold. The biting wind nearly drove him to surrender and despair.

Yet his hope for another world was greater than the suffering he endured.

It allowed him to persist under any condition.

The wind grew stronger, and eventually rain fell upon the night.

Still, Hong Min endured. His suffering intensified—but so did his hope.

Several times, Hong Min nearly fainted from the cold. Each time, he bit his tongue to remain conscious.

Not long after, a radiant Emblem appeared.

Its light was so brilliant that Hong Min had to squint his eyes.

"Who are you?" Hong Min asked, shielding his vision from the overwhelming glow.

"Oh human, I am the 'Emblem of Hope.' I have come because your hope is so great that it summoned me here."

Hong Min was confused. Was this the one the Emblem of Opportunity had spoken of?

Seeing the doubt on Hong Min's face, the Emblem of Opportunity explained,

"Yes. With its help, we can leave this boundless sea."

Hong Min nodded after hearing the confirmation.

"Oh Emblem of Hope, how do I use you? And what price must I pay?" Hong Min asked, still squinting against the light.

"Oh human, offer me your heart, and I shall fill it. As long as you possess hope, I will remain with you," the voice of the Emblem of Hope echoed through the rain.

Hong Min surrendered his heart.

The Emblem of Hope entered the empty space within it.

A radiant light burst forth from Hong Min's chest.

Unable to endure the cold any longer, Hong Min finally lost consciousness.

The next morning, Hong Min awoke as sunlight warmed his face.

To his astonishment, what lay before him was no longer the boundless sea—

but a vast land stretching endlessly before his eyes.

Tears streamed down Hong Min's face as joy overwhelmed him.

Seeing his happiness, the Emblem of Opportunity spoke.

"Human, your opportunity has arrived. I will now depart. May we meet again someday."

Hong Min bowed his head in gratitude to the Emblem of Opportunity, which had accompanied him all this time.

They parted ways.

The Emblem of Opportunity drifted away.

Hong Min stepped down from his ship.

He placed his foot upon the world he had dreamed of.

A new land.

A new beginning.

A world born from choice, opportunity, and hope.
